Canopus, and a few other companies make anologue to digital converters. Also, many cameras and dvdecks have a "pass through" feature, meaning you can input your analogue video into the inputs of the camera, and it will allow you to capture it as dv through the firewire out into your IEEE card and capture software. : Most HP CPUs have a firewire these days for NLE systems, now the question I have is: how do you import your old S-VHS or VHS footage into your NLE software? : Is there an adaptor that can be placed between the IEEE and S-VHS or RCA for Audio and Video imports? : Would Vegas Video 4.0 support VHS as well or only digital?
